It means that you have a constant flow of air while youre speaking. So, before you start to speak, let air out for about one second, then start speaking into the exhale. Then, link your words together. Think of it like, instead of your sentence being individual words, it's one long word. Keep your voice "on" throughout the entire thing. If you need to pause or take a breath, do the exhale thing again.
